    Newcastle ready to sell Steven Taylor

    Newcastle have placed central defender Steven Taylor on the transfer list.

    The 24-year-old is out of contract at the end of the season and the Magpies want to cash in now rather than risk losing him for nothing next summer.

    A club statement confirmed: "Newcastle have placed Steven Taylor on the transfer list. The club will be making no further comment at this time."

    Local lad Taylor, who played 29 times for England Under-21s, was seen as a rising star a few years ago but injuries and controversy have slowed his progress.

    He missed the second half of last season as Newcastle won the Championship, firstly having been ruled out with a knee injury.

    And then, as he was close to a first-team return in March, he suffered a fractured jaw in a training ground bust-up with Andy Carroll.

    He is currently sidelined after dislocating a shoulder during pre-season, an injury that is expected to keep him out for around three months.
